Russian Sanctions Affect Long-Term Price of Oil

The Financial Times reports that “Since sanctions were announced at the end of last month, those monitoring the oil industry have questioned whether the restrictions placed on Russia by the EU and the US are just a piece of ‘theatre’ without any meaningful impact.”  

“And with good reason.”  

The restrictions apply to the ‘sale, supply, transfer or export [of certain technologies] in connection with a project pertaining to deep sea drilling, arctic exploration or shale oil.'”
